Since our humble beginnings in 1990, Poundland has evolved into a retail powerhouse with over 650 stores and nearly 13,000 dedicated colleagues across the UK and Republic of Ireland. The addition of Dealz in 2011 further solidified our presence, enabling us to reach millions of customers with our unparalleled value offerings.

Be Ready for Role-Playing Scenarios

Many retail interviews include role-playing scenarios where we might have to deal with a difficult customer or upsell a product. Practising these scenarios with a friend or family member can help us feel more comfortable. The key here is to showcase our problem-solving skills and ability to remain calm under pressure!
